A few steps that you may follow in creating an effective apology letter are as follows: Start creating your apology letter by first identifying its purpose.

As any formal letter samples will show you, indicating the reason first and foremost will immediately inform the reader of what they are to expect when they read it in its entirety. Make sure to list down the reasons why the letter needs to be created and what the apology is all about.

Create a brief idea about the mistake that you committed or any other items that you feel sorry about. This will set the mood and will let the letter receiver understand why the apology letter is needed. Once you have already given an idea of the mistake, specify facts that are involved during the incident. More so, discuss the chronological occurrences of the incidents that transpired so it will be easier for the letter receiver to remember the transaction. Following the formal letter format , you must not give any more detail than is necessary.

Only stick to what is relevant to your message. Always own up all the wrong things that you have done. You need to let the receiver of the letter feel that you understand that they were either hurt or disappointed. I realize that my mistake made you miss your flight and caused you unnecessary stress. Owning up to your mistake from the very beginning of your letter will help you seem sincere and humble. It will also ensure that your recipient hears about your mistake from you instead of through office gossip.

Confronting your mistake and reaching out to the affected party directly will help you resolve the issue as quickly as possible. The next step in writing your letter is to apologize. A sincere apology will involve saying "I am sorry" without any excuses or caveats. In many cases, a genuine apology that does not attempt to shift blame to anyone else is sufficient in earning your recipient's forgiveness.

Part of apologizing sincerely is expressing your regret for the consequences you caused. For example, you might say:. I felt awful when I heard that you had to reschedule your meeting with accounting because of my forgetfulness. In addition to expressing your regret, you will also need to find a way to improve the situation.

Assuring your recipient that you will do everything you can to make the matter right is a good place to start, but it will be even better if you can share the specific steps you will take to do so.

Having this kind of plan shows your recipient that you recognize you owe them in some way and that you have put serious thought into how you can make the situation better. For example, you might write:. I have already called the district office and scheduled a meeting so I can explain that I am actually the one to blame. Your letter should conclude with a specific attempt at making things right between you and your recipient.

In most cases, this should involve a direct request for forgiveness. Asking for forgiveness shows that you realize the matter is not truly resolved until your relationship with the recipient is mended. It also invites the recipient to contribute to resolving the issue and finding closure. An example of this might be:. I know that my mistake upset you, but I can hope we can resolve this and continue to work well together. Depending on the situation and your relationship with the recipient, you might choose to either email your letter, send it by post or deliver it in person.

You can help to rebuild your credulity in your apology letter if you promise not to repeat the offense and assure the injured party that they will see a definite change in your behavior.

You can use your apology letter to assure the injured party that you truly value their friendship and do not want to lose it. Just writing an apology letter shows the injured party that you realize you were wrong and that you value the relationship.
